Roberta L. Carter Christian, drifted off into eternal rest on Tuesday, August 13, 2019, at home in Williamsburg, Virginia. She was born on May 12, 1945, the daughter of the late Louise Foster and Garland Carter.
At an early age, she confessed Christ as her Personal Savior and joined Mt. Zion Baptist Church, in Church View, Virginia. She was educated in Middlesex Public Schools. As a caring and compassionate person, she enjoyed a successful career helping people as a Nursing Assistant. In 2010, she married Willie Christian.
